💡 Tips

  • Due to the high altitude on the slopes of Irazú, the weather is notably chilly; bring a warm jacket.
  • The town is surrounded by scenic agricultural fields, making for great landscape photography.
  • It's an excellent stopover on your way to or from the Irazú Volcano National Park.
  • Public transport is less frequent than in the lowlands, so traveling by car or joining a tour is recommended.

🍽 Food

🍽
Potato Dishes

Cot is prime potato-growing country; expect deliciously fresh potatoes in local stews and side dishes.

🍽
Agua Dulce

Warm up with this traditional hot drink made from sugarcane, well-suited for the cool mountain climate.

🍽
Picadillo de Papa

A comforting local dish of diced potatoes, meat, and spices, found in small sodas.

Cot is a scenic mountain village located on the fertile southern slopes of the Irazú Volcano in the Cartago province. As one of the oldest settlements in Costa Rica, with historical records dating back to 1522, it retains a peaceful colonial atmosphere. The area is famous for its high-altitude agriculture, where the rich volcanic soil supports vast fields of potatoes and onions that create a spirited green patchwork across the landscape. Visitors often stop here while traveling toward the volcano's crater to enjoy the crisp, cool air and the sweeping views of the Cartago valley below. The local San Antonio de Padua church is a significant landmark, representing the village's deep-rooted religious traditions and offering a glimpse into the region's historical architectural style.
